The Crew’s Latest Update Adds a New PvP Mode

February 8, 2015 by Ian Miles Cheong

A new PvP mode and framerate improvements are coming to The Crew.

Ubisoft has announced that next week’s update for The Crew will tune several major gameplay aspects and add an all new mode to the game’s multiplayer. The new mode will be a PvP race elimination mode on ten new tracks. There will also be four new faction missions for players to experience. 

Additionally, the patch will include a number of tweaks that will improve the framerate in cockpit view and adjust the handling of some vehicles. 

Beyond the update, The Crew is set to receive its second DLC — the Speed Car Pack, which includes three new vehicles, later this month. 

Here’s what’s in store with the patch, which comes out on February 12:

New Content

New PvP mode – an elimination race with ten new tracks available.

Four new faction missions.

Fixes and Updates

Online

The quick co-op feature has been improved, and several bugs related to joining sessions have been fixed.

PvP lobby improvements – Can now browse players after selecting cars.

PvP session improvements for faster matchmaking.

Statistics

Fixed the issue that was causing statistics to display incorrect data and/or simply reset the data. Previous data will not be restored, but new statistics should not be lost anymore.

Awards

Fixed an issue related to unlocking and tracking the progress of certain awards.

Challenges

Fixed an issue related to progression on challenges.

Frame rate

Improved frame rate in cockpit view.

UI

Fixed an issue when applying certain parts.

Friends

Fixed an issue related to a friend’s presence in game – their status will be set to offline when they quit the game.

Cars

Improvements and tweaking of several cars’ handling and speed.

Buggy’s grip has been improved in order for it to be able to climb hills as other Raid cars.

Fixed a bug where some cars were able to reach an extreme off-road top speed in reverse gear for: Bentley Continental GT, Cadillac Escalade, Abarth 500, Alfa Romeo 4C and Hummer H1 Alpha.

MINI Cooper S in Circuit Spec: Toned down the nitro and grip.

Lamborghini Murcielago in Circuit Spec: Grip slightly improved when using nitro.

Missions

AI behavior in some missions improved.

AI and police car behavior in chase missions improved: – Opponent cars are now less aggressive, and they try more to follow players instead of taking them down.

Gameplay

Modifications applied to the friction on side barriers in order to avoid wall-riding exploit.
